A nursing assistant working with Nursa provides basic care and helps patients with activities of daily living under the supervision of a licensed nurse. Nursing assistants work in a variety of nursing and residential care facilities, long-term care centers, assisted living facilities (ALFs), hospitals, home healthcare services, and more.

CNA Responsibilities:

Allowing for some variation in duties from one work setting to another, the following are typical responsibilities of CNAs:

  • Assist patients with activities of daily living, including bathing, toileting, dressing, feeding, and walking or exercising
  • Record vital signs, height, and weight 
  • Measure and record dietary intake and output
  • Observe or examine patients to detect symptoms that may require medical attention 
  • Document all care provided and refused and submit paperwork
  • Maintain patient confidentiality
  • Assist nurses or physicians in the operation of medical equipment or provision of care
  • Transport patients to treatment units, operating rooms, or other areas using wheelchairs, stretchers, or movable beds 
  • Clean and sanitize patients’ clothing, rooms, bathrooms, examination rooms, or other areas, maintaining safety standards and infection control procedures

About Required CNA License:

Requirements to work as a nursing assistant can vary significantly from state to state. To become a certified nursing assistant (CNA), an individual generally has to obtain a high school diploma or equivalent and/or complete a state-approved CNA program. Other typical requirements include completing an application, paying required fees, and passing a nursing assistant competency examination. Each state also has particular requirements for maintaining a certification active and/or renewing certification.

What Do PRN CNAs Do in Phillipsburg?

In Phillipsburg, PRN CNAs are responsible for providing basic care services to patients and assisting licensed healthcare professionals (registered nurses or licensed practical nurses) with medical procedures. This may include taking vital signs, monitoring and recording patient progress, assisting with daily activities, and more. PRN CNAs may work in a variety of healthcare settings.

Working as a PRN CNA in Phillipsburg can be both challenging and rewarding. A typical day may start with checking Nursa for available shifts, getting ready, and heading to the facility. Once there, the CNA will receive a report from the previous shift and begin their daily tasks. The day may include:

  • Assisting patients with their daily activities.
  • Providing personal care.
  • Monitoring vital signs.
  • Communicating with the healthcare team about any changes in a patient's condition.

The CNA may also attend to any urgent issues during the shift.

A typical day for a CNA in Phillipsburg may involve physical and administrative tasks. CNAs may spend the day on their feet, assisting patients with mobility and performing basic medical procedures. They may also document patient progress, administer medications, and update patient records. Every day is different for a CNA, as they work with diverse patients with varying needs and requirements.
